


The Dilemma
Longtime friends Ronny and Nick are partners in an auto-design firm. They are hard at work on a presentation for a dream project that would really launch their company. Then Ronny spots Nick's wife out with another man, and in the process of investigating the possible affair, he learns that Nick has a few secrets of his own. As the presentation nears, Ronny agonizes over what might happen if the truth gets out.

Critical Reception
The Dilemma received generally negative reviews from critics, who found the film's premise and execution to be inconsistent and unfocused. While some praised the performances of the lead actors, many felt the movie struggled to balance its comedic and dramatic elements, ultimately failing to deliver a satisfying narrative. Audience reception was similarly lukewarm, with many finding the plot convoluted and the humor lacking.
